Behind the Creation

I decided to take an online course on AI filmmaking. Become a Content Creator. Today’s lesson was about cloning yourself and creating different settings. I began with a contact sheet of headshots in different poses. It was 4 AM, and I was still bleary-eyed, mind you, when I took these. I used the contact sheet as reference photos for Gemini AI on Google; it is fast and efficient and came up with these fun, imaginary “what I want to be when I grow up” images.

Important note: I learned that it is best to take pictures with the back of the camera on your iPhone, not a selfie. It made a difference in photo quality. And giving your best AI prompts is equally important to get the image the way you want it.

At 70, I am not slowing down creatively—I am beginning a new chapter.

I’m learning AI filmmaking, writing mysteries, and designing puzzle and coloring books. Retirement, I’m discovering, can be a wonderful time for reinvention.

Some days I feel confident. Other days I press the wrong button and have to begin again. But every attempt teaches me something—and every small success encourages me to keep going.

It is never too late to become a beginner again.
